How much do night shift prior authorization jobs pay per hour?

As of Aug 10, 2026, the average hourly pay for night shift prior authorization in the United States is $22.37, according to ZipRecruiter salary data. Most workers in this role earn between $15.87 and $28.61 per hour, depending on experience, location, and employer.

What is a night shift prior authorization specialist?

A Night Shift Prior Authorization specialist is a healthcare professional responsible for processing and reviewing prior authorization requests for medical procedures, medications, or treatments during overnight hours. These specialists verify insurance coverage, ensure that required documentation is provided, and communicate with healthcare providers to facilitate approvals. Working the night shift helps ensure that authorizations are handled promptly around the clock, reducing delays in patient care and improving workflow for both patients and providers.

What are some common challenges faced by night shift prior authorization specialists and how can they be addressed?

Night Shift Prior Authorization specialists often encounter challenges such as limited immediate access to providers for clarification, managing urgent requests with fewer on-site resources, and maintaining focus during overnight hours. To address these, strong communication skills for thorough documentation, familiarity with digital authorization tools, and effective time management are crucial. Building a routine, utilizing available support channels, and staying updated on payer requirements can help specialists navigate these unique aspects of the night shift successfully.

What are the key skills and qualifications needed to thrive as a night shift prior authorization specialist?

To excel as a Night Shift Prior Authorization Specialist, you need a solid understanding of insurance procedures, medical terminology, and prior authorization processes, often supported by a high school diploma or healthcare-related certification. Familiarity with insurance portals, electronic medical records (EMR), and prior authorization software is typically required. Strong attention to detail, effective communication, and the ability to work independently during off-hours are important soft skills. These abilities ensure timely and accurate processing of authorizations, minimizing delays in patient care and supporting 24/7 healthcare operations.

Responsibilities
  • The Prior Authorization Coordinator is responsible for striving to complete either approval for pharmacy claims requiring prior authorization or by coordinating with prescribers and or facility contact to have therapy changed to a preferred alternative due to insurance not covering the treatment in question
Essential Job Responsibilities:
  • Ensure accurate and timely completion of client prior authorization and/or change of therapy paperwork by collaborating with prescribers and facility contacts
  • Follows up on all claims requiring prior authorization within four to five business days
  • Tracks and reviews all claims in QuickBase and sends excel tracking spreadsheet to Director of Pharmacy on weekly basis
  • Compares system report of unbilled claims requiring prior approval to QuickBase tracking system to ensure any claim requiring prior authorization is being followed up on
  • Assists Billing Department with resolving unbilled claims at each month end close
  • Advocates for clients as needed
  • Support for Pharmacy Operations
  • Adjudicates and resolution of claim rejections as needed
  • Utilizes Frameworks, QuickBase, Docutrack, and CoverMyMeds in order to complete workflow on daily basis
  • Other responsibilities as assigned

Qualifications
  • High School Diploma/General Education Diploma required
  • Kentucky Pharmacy Technician License preferred
  • Excellent customer service and communication skills, both written and verbal
  • Ability to prioritize and meet pre-determined deadlines
  • Must be able to effectively multi-task, be proficient at typing, and have advanced technical skills
  • Experience in healthcare billing environment (pharmacy preferred)
  • Familiarization with on-line claims processing and Medicaid and Medicare billing practices
  • Proficient with Microsoft Word & Excel required
